Warwick's Applied Linguistics program provides a distinctive way to examine language: we use linguistic theories and insights to tackle practical challenges. The Linguistics with Chinese (BA) program helps you develop interdisciplinary expertise based on cutting-edge research in language and communication. You'll then use this knowledge to investigate, question, comprehend, and resolve issues with impactful solutions.
Combining linguistics with Chinese studies allows you to discover the remarkable human ability for language while advancing your Chinese proficiency. As a linguistics student, you'll examine language structure, functionality, and its connection to society.
The program includes training in written and spoken Chinese, along with cross-cultural communication skills. Your linguistic analysis abilities will enhance your language acquisition, while your Chinese expertise will enrich your work as a linguist. This degree prepares you for diverse careers that demand both modern language proficiency and comprehensive understanding of language, culture, and communication.
(75% linguistics, 25% Chinese).
